Changelog
+Daniel (11 August 2004)
+- configure now defines _XOPEN_SOURCE to 500 on systems that need it to build
+ warning-free (the only known one so far is non-gcc builds on 64bit SGI
+ IRIX).
+
+- the FTP code now includes the server response in the error message when the
+ server gives back a 530 after the password is provided, as it isn't
+ necessary because of a bad user name or password.
+
